stress-induced hyperprolactinemia

Elevated prolactin levels resulting from psychological or physiological stress that activates hypothalamic-pituitary pathways.

Full Definition

Stress-induced hyperprolactinemia is a condition characterized by elevated prolactin levels that occur in response to acute or chronic psychological or physiological stressors. Stress activates the hypothalamic-pituitary-adrenal axis and can simultaneously stimulate prolactin release through various mechanisms including reduced dopaminergic inhibition, increased thyrotropin-releasing hormone (TRH), and direct stress hormone effects on lactotrophs. This condition is commonly observed in clinical settings during medical procedures, psychiatric episodes, or severe illness. Unlike pathological hyperprolactinemia from adenomas, stress-induced elevations are typically transient and resolve when the stressor is removed. However, chronic stress can lead to sustained prolactin elevation with clinical consequences.
